Wacky Dorez 8 is a regular weight, normal width, low cont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

This font uses angular, faceted letterforms with uneven stroke edges and subtly inconsistent widths, creating a deliberately rough, hand-cut silhouette. Stems and terminals often taper or flare slightly, and many curves are resolved into straight segments, giving rounds like O and Q a polygonal feel. Counters are compact and irregular, with occasional notch-like joins and kinked diagonals that add visual tension. Spacing and sidebearings read a bit uneven by design, producing an animated rhythm in words and lines.

Best suited for short display settings where texture and character are the goal—posters, cover titling, event promos, game or Halloween-themed graphics, and expressive packaging. It can also work for pull quotes or section headers when you want an intentionally irregular, handmade voice, but the jagged rhythm makes it less appropriate for long-form reading.

The overall tone is mischievous and unconventional, with a DIY, cut-paper energy that feels more like a prop or sign than a neutral text face. Its irregularity and angularity create a light spooky-cartoon edge, suggesting humor, mystery, and playful disruption rather than polish or formality.

The design appears intended to deliver an intentionally imperfect, hand-crafted display look—like letters cut from paper or roughly carved—while maintaining clear letter identities. Its consistent use of faceting and uneven edges prioritizes personality and motion on the page over typographic neutrality.

Uppercase forms tend to look more emblematic and carved, while the lowercase keeps the same faceted logic but with simpler construction, helping it remain readable at display sizes. Numerals follow the same chunky, skewed geometry, with distinctive polygonal bowls and sharp corners that match the alphabet.
